chenchaod 2ヶ月前
コミット
f50d8a199a

+ 14
- 12
zhywpt-service-ods/src/main/java/cn/com/taiji/ods/manager/ois/issue/OrderSaveManagerImpl.java ファイルの表示

@@ -70,8 +70,8 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cOrderVehicleInfo.setEngineNum(vehicle.getEngineNum());
etcOrderVehicleInfo.setType(vehicle.getType());
etcOrderVehicleInfo.setUseCharacter(vehicle.getUseCharacter());
etcOrderVehicleInfo.setRegisterDate(vehicle.getRegisterDate().format(D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ss")));
etcOrderVehicleInfo.setIssueDate(vehicle.getRegisterDate().format(D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ss")));
etcOrderVehicleInfo.setRegisterDate(vehicle.getRegisterDate());
etcOrderVehicleInfo.setIssueDate(vehicle.getRegisterDate());
etcOrderVehicleInfo.setFileNum(vehicle.getFileNum());
etcOrderVehicleInfo.setApprovedCount(vehicle.getApprovedCount());
etcOrderVehicleInfo.setTotalMass(vehicle.getTotalMass().intValue());
@@ -82,12 +82,12 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cOrderVehicleInfo.setPermittedTowWeight(vehicle.getPermittedTowWeight().intValue());
etcOrderVehicleInfo.setAxleDistance(vehicle.getAxleDistance());
etcOrderVehicleInfo.setTestRecord(vehicle.getTestRecord());
// etcOrderVehicleInfo.setWheelCount(vehicle.getWheelCount());
etcOrderVehicleInfo.setWheelCount(vehicle.getVehicleWheelCount());
etcOrderVehicleInfo.setAxisType(vehicle.getAxisType());
// etcOrderVehicleInfo.setOwnerIdNum(vehicle.getOwnerIdNum());
// etcOrderVehicleInfo.setOwnerIdType(vehicle.getOwnerIdType());
etcOrderVehicleInfo.setOwnerIdNum(vehicle.getOwnerIdNum());
etcOrderVehicleInfo.setOwnerIdType(vehicle.getOwnerIdType().getCode());
etcOrderVehicleInfo.setOwnerTel(vehicle.getOwnerTel());
// etcOrderVehicleInfo.setTransportIdNum(vehicle.getTransportIdNum());
etcOrderVehicleInfo.setTransportIdNum(vehicle.getTransportIdNum());
// etcOrderVehicleInfo.setRoadTransCertUrl(vehicle.getRoadTransportPermitPicUrl());
}
etcOrderVehicleInfo.setCustomerType(order.getUserType().getCode());
@@ -107,8 +107,8 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cOrderUserInfo.setIdentNo(order.getCustomerIdNum());
etcOrderUserInfo.setIdentType(order.getCustomerIdType().getCode());
etcOrderUserInfo.setUserMobile(order.getCustomerTel());
// etcOrderUserInfo.setAddress(ext.getCustomerAddress());
// etcOrderUserInfo.setDepartment(ext.getCustomerDepartment());
etcOrderUserInfo.setAddress(ext.getCustomerAddress());
etcOrderUserInfo.setDepartment(ext.getCustomerDepartment());
etcOrderUserInfo.setAgentName(order.getAgentName());
etcOrderUserInfo.setAgentIdType(order.getAgentIdType().getCode());
etcOrderUserInfo.setAgentIdNum(order.getAgentIdNum());
@@ -120,12 +120,12 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cApplyOrder.setOrgcode(order.getAccountId());
if (order.getOrderStatus() == IssueOrderStatus.CANCEL) {
//需要判断退货还是撤销
if (ShippingStatus.RECEIVED.name().equals(order.getShippingStatus())) {
if (ShippingStatus.RECEIVED.equals(order.getShippingStatus())) {
etcApplyOrder.setOrderstatus(-3);
} else {
etcApplyOrder.setOrderstatus(-2);
}
} else if (order.getOrderStep().equals("7")) {
} else if (order.getOrderStep().getCode().equals(7)) {
etcApplyOrder.setOrderstatus(-1);
} else {
//判断审核之后
@@ -156,7 +156,7 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cApplyOrder.setReviewer(order.getAuditOpId());
etcApplyOrder.setReviewopinion(ext.getAuditFailureCase());
etcApplyOrder.setReviewstatus(order.getArtificialStatus() == 0?0:1);
etcApplyOrder.setDeliverystatus(ShippingStatus.RECEIVED.name().equals(order.getShippingStatus())?1:0);
etcApplyOrder.setDeliverystatus(ShippingStatus.RECEIVED.equals(order.getShippingStatus())?1:0);
etcApplyOrder.setCardid(order.getCardId());
etcApplyOrder.setObuid(order.getObuId());
etcApplyOrder.setPromoterchannelnum(order.getAccountId());
@@ -173,7 +173,7 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cApplyOrder.setOpencardtime(order.getCardEnableTime());
etcApplyOrder.setOpenobutime(order.getObuEnableTime());
etcApplyOrder.setActivetime(order.getActivationTime());
// etcApplyOrder.setCanceltime(ext.getCancelTime());
etcApplyOrder.setCanceltime(order.getCancelTime());
etcApplyOrder.setCancelreason(ext.getCancelReason());
etcApplyOrder.setReturngoodstime(order.getReturnGoodsTime());
etcApplyOrder.setDeliverytime(order.getDeliveryTime());
@@ -184,6 +184,8 @@ public class OrderSaveManagerImpl extends AbstractManager implements OrderSaveMa
etcApplyOrder.setApplysourcetype(6);
} else if (SourceType.SERVICE_HALL.equals(order.getOrderSource())) {
etcApplyOrder.setApplysourcetype(1);
}else if (SourceType.CHANNEL.equals(order.getOrderSource())) {
etcApplyOrder.setApplysourcetype(7);
}
etcApplyOrder.setCreatetime(order.getInsertTime());
etcApplyOrder.setUpdatetime(order.getUpdateTime());

読み込み中…
キャンセル
保存